关于git和github版本管理的疑问,先谢谢大家了,80分~~
1 如果有人提交了一个不成功的版本,其他人是不是要等到成功了才能提交 2 git合并的原理是什么 3 如果不同人在编写的模块之间有依赖关系,是不是要等到别人写完才能继续 4 如果现在github库里有一个成功的版本,此时有A、B两个开发人员在此基础上各自开发新的功能,直到完成项目之前,接下 来的步骤应该是怎样的
最满意答案
楼主 我一个问题一个问题的回答哈 1、git是分布式管理,也就是说服务器上的和本地的可以随时同步更新,当你提交不成功时,你所更改的文件会放在缓存区,别人来提交的时候会一起把所有更改的文件提交,建议代码入库不要多个人来操作 一个人就好了 这样子不容易出错。 2、git分支间的合并---是把两个分之间不同的修改合并到一起,如果遇到冲突(比如修改到了同一个文件),就会提示你,让你忽略或者是手动处理。(建议手动处理) 3、不用,你就在本地客户端克隆一个代码库,然后进行本地修改,到时候代码入库的时候注意一个先后顺序就行了。 4、为什么要在服务器上改呢?直接在本地进行开发,然后在进行服务器的代码同步不就好了吗更多推荐
发布评论